pre·board
P p - verb with object preboard to put or allow to go aboard in advance of the usual time or before others: Passengers with disabilities will be preboarded. 1
- verb without object preboard to go aboard in advance. 1
- verb preboard to (allow to) board a plane before other passengers 0
- verb preboard to set the shape of (a garment, esp stockings) using heat, so that it will not lose its shape during washing 0
